If not, see #' Determine the SSLRC mobility classification for a chemical substance from its Koc #' #' This implements the method specified in the UK data requirements handbook and was #' checked against the spreadsheet published on the CRC website #' #' @param Koc The sorption coefficient normalised to organic carbon in L/kg #' @return A list containing the classification and the percentage of the #' compound transported per 10 mm drain water #' @export #' @author Johannes Ranke #' @examples #' SSLRC_mobility_classification(100) SSLRC_mobility_classification <- function(Koc) { if (!is.numeric(Koc) | length(Koc) != 1) stop("Please give a single number") if (is.na(Koc)) { result <- list(NA, NA) } else { result <- list("Non mobile", 0.01) if (Koc < 4000) result <- list("Slightly mobile", 0.02) if (Koc < 1000) result <- list("Slightly mobile", 0.5) if (Koc < 500) result <- list("Moderately mobile", 0.7) if (Koc < 75) result <- list("Mobile", 1.9) if (Koc < 15) result <- list("Very mobile", 1.9) } names(result) <- c("Mobility classification", "Percentage drained per mm of drain water") return(result) }
